Stupid bank fees

Thoughts Add comments

Cena and i split our monthly bills. We each pay our share for groceries, utilities, and household expenses. So once a month i transfer money to her account (utilities are in her name and she usually pays for food). I usually just call up the bank, give my account number, verify my identification, and give the amount and her name. Yesterday when i called to do that i was told that they now charge $2 for transfers over the telephone.

What?

In less than one year Cena and i have made $10,439.45 in interest payments to First Bank.  So they have plenty of my money.  I use direct deposit and automatic or electronic payments for every single bill except for this monthly payment to Cena.  So i hardly ever take any of their employees time making a deposit or by cashing my checks.  Now they are going to charge me to do something that takes an employee less than two minutes?
